BDO assures reimbursement to affected clients after hacking incident

Several BDO consumers have disclosed on social media how their bank accounts were targeted and became subject to internet hacking, resulting in financial transfers ranging from P25,000 to P50,000 conducted without the authorization of the bank’s owners and depositors, while the matter stays in the mainstream media. 

BDO reacted immediately to these incidents, issuing announcements about the ongoing cyber-attack.
BDO also advises clients to update their passwords in order to increase account security and prevent fraudsters from gaining access to their hard-earned money. Furthermore, BDO promised that all impacted innocent consumers will be compensated for their losses.
BDO continues to advise customers not to disclose login information such as usernames, passwords, or one-time passwords (OTP). Clients are recommended to update their online bank account passwords on a frequent basis for enhanced safety and security.

Clients can report suspicious instances to ReportPhish@bdo.com.ph or contact the company’s employees, looking for BDO Customer Care with a blue Facebook verified checkmark. Clients can also contact BDO at callcenter@bdo.com.ph or call its hotline at 8631-8000.
